Abstract
- The resected tumour specimen is loaded into the specimen bag, and an incision of approximately 4 cm is made in the middle of the upper abdomen to remove the specimen. We present herein Video S1 of total laparoscopic left hemicolectomy using a novel IA method of U-tied end-to-end anastomosis (UEEA). Several studies have demonstrated that intracorporeal anastomosis (IA) has a lower overall complication rate [[1]], shorter hospital stay and less postoperative pain than extracorporeal anastomosis in laparoscopic right hemicolectomy for colorectal cancer [[2]].
